Dissidents urge Western action as China targets critics overseas

Alleged Chinese police stations overseas raise concerns Beijing is formalising surveillance far beyond its borders.

from Al Jazeera – Breaking News, World News and Video from Al Jazeera https://ift.tt/be1ADGH

Post a Comment

0 Comments